    Was reading his caption and noticed the theme of manifestation so I decided to do a little digging

    He's manifested both of his mansions:

    “This house was the desktop image on my computer years before I bought it,” Drake says. “I was like, ‘What are the world’s craziest residential pools?’ and when I searched online, this came up.” In 2007, a then-unsigned Drake tried, and failed, to hunt this place down during an L.A. trip. In 2009, the compound hit the market with an asking price of $27 million. The seller, a steakhouse-chain restaurateur, “was at a low moment,” Drake recalls. “He needed money.” In 2012, Drake purchased the property for $7.7 million. “I stole it from him!”

    rollingstone.com/music/news/drake-high-times-at-the-yolo-estate-20140213

    This is something that Napoleon Hill writes extensively about in his book titled, "Think and Grow Rich." It's the epitome of "The Secret," which is essentially a modern reimagination of Think and Grow Rich. It's not necessarily about envisioning things and then having them come to you in mysterious ways. No, it's more about thinking about your ideal life in such a way, that you begin to obsess over it. So much so, that envisioning your future self to such an extent actually causes you to make decisions in the present moment that guide you towards the life you dream of. Powerful stuff when broken down in simple terms.

    These manifestation gurus tell us, with a wealth of vague detail, that you can visualize and manifest whatever you want.

    Example:

    Let's say I am in the e-commerce business. To increase that business all I have to do is imagine it increased to "see" last week's orders increased by 50, then by 100 and so forth, until well, these people are shy about giving limits, but if the law is true for 50, it ought to be true for 1 million if I can imagine so many. Of course, the law is not true; it is quack psychology.

    Humans have a psychological tendency to believe that just because event A happened before event B, event A caused event B. This is the correlation/causation error.

    The manifestation/LOA business preys on people who don't understand logic, statistics, or science. It's a good business model, and if your primary goal is to separate uneducated people from their money, you can make a large fortune.
